Transaction 6bcc55c5ea167900fb5959183a0f2fd185fa6defd109bb4468e7aeb45bccad10
1 Input
1 Output
-
6bcc55c5ea167900fb5959183a0f2fd185fa6defd109bb4468e7aeb45bccad10:0
- value
- 92808342
- script pubkey
- OP_0 OP_PUSHBYTES_20 cfbaf7613480f2242a94867ea18e8fce62c4c99a
- address
- bc1qe7a0wcf5srezg255sel2rr50ee3vfjv6nm5wdw